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es of your call and begin assessing the damage. They’ll use moisture meters to detect hidden water and identify the source of the leak.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will extract water from your bathroom using powerful pumps and vacuums. We’ll remove standing water, wet flooring, and saturated materials to prevent further damage and promote drying.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use advanced drying equipment and protocols to dry your bathroom in as little as 3-5 days. Our technicians will monitor moisture levels and adjust their equipment as needed to ensure your bathroom is dry and safe to use.
Step 4: Antimicrobial Treatment
Our team will apply antimicrobial treatment services to remove any bacteria, mold, or mildew growth. This ensures your bathroom is safe to use and free from health risks.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under the sink |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with a few basic tools.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Visible mold growth on bathroom walls | No | Yes | This needs professional equipment and expertise to remove health risks.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air or replace flooring. |
| Leaks from the toilet or shower | No | Yes | This needs professional equipment and expertise to identify and fix the source of the leak. |
| Large water damage from a flood |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ore your bathroom. |

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Stow, OH
The cost of Bathroom Water Damage Restoration in Stow, OH var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the complexity of the job.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the number of drying equipment units needed. |
| Antimicrobial treatment |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the mold or mildew growth and the size of the affected area. |
| Repair or replacement of damaged materials | $500 – $5,000 | The type and quantity of materials needed for repair or replacement. |
| Professional labor costs | $500 – $2,000 | The number of technicians needed and the complexity of the job. |
| Equipment rental fees | $100 – $500 | The type and quantity of equipment needed for the job. |

How do I prevent water damage in my bathroom?
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age in your bathroom. Check your bathroom’s fixtures, pipes, and appliances regularly for signs of wear and tear. Fix any leaks or issues quickly, and consider installing a water sensor to detect hidden water damage.
